About Constitutional Law in Cerritos, United States

Constitutional law is the body of law that interprets and applies the United States Constitution at both federal and state levels. In Cerritos, located in California, constitutional law addresses issues involving rights and powers defined by federal and California state constitutions. This can include areas such as freedom of speech, equal protection, due process, and the separation of powers between government branches. Although national and state constitutions form the foundation, local governments like Cerritos must adhere to constitutional limitations while governing or enacting local ordinances.

Local Laws Overview

Cerritos is a city within Los Angeles County, California. While federal and state constitutional principles govern most issues, local laws (municipal codes, regulations, and policies) must comply with these higher authorities. Some key aspects relevant to constitutional law include:

  • Freedom of Speech and Assembly: Cerritos must allow citizens to express their opinions and gather peacefully, as protected by the First Amendment. However, the city can regulate the time, place, and manner of these activities for public safety.
  • Equal Protection: Local government actions in Cerritos cannot discriminate on the basis of race, gender, religion, or other protected categories.
  • Due Process: The city must provide fair procedures before denying any resident their rights or property.
  • Ordinance Challenges: Residents may challenge city ordinances if they believe the laws infringe on constitutional rights.
  • Search and Seizure: Local law enforcement must comply with Fourth Amendment protections against unreasonable searches and seizures.

Because local rules must always align with state and federal constitutions, anyone in Cerritos who feels their rights have been violated has the ability to challenge such actions through legal means.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is constitutional law?

Constitutional law involves interpreting and applying the United States and state constitutions to protect individual rights, define government powers, and resolve disputes between individuals and government entities.

Do I have First Amendment rights in Cerritos?

Yes, residents and visitors in Cerritos have First Amendment rights, including freedom of speech, religion, assembly, and the press. Any local law or policy that infringes on these freedoms can be subject to legal challenge.

When can I challenge a city ordinance as unconstitutional?

You can challenge a city ordinance if you believe it violates your federal or state constitutional rights, such as by restricting your free speech, targeting specific groups unfairly, or denying due process.

What should I do if my rights are violated by local law enforcement?

If you believe your constitutional rights have been violated by Cerritos law enforcement, document the incident and contact a constitutional law attorney immediately. You may also file a complaint with local or state oversight bodies.

Can students invoke constitutional rights in Cerritos public schools?

Yes, students have constitutional rights at school, such as freedom of expression and due process. However, these rights can be subject to certain limitations for safety and order in educational environments.

How do I know if I have an equal protection claim?

If you have been treated differently by a government entity because of your race, gender, religion, or another protected characteristic, you may have an equal protection claim under federal or state constitutions.

What is due process and how does it apply locally?

Due process requires that the local government follow fair procedures before depriving anyone of life, liberty, or property. In Cerritos, this means any legal action against you by the city must follow transparent and fair procedures.

How can a constitutional law attorney help me?

An attorney can advise you on your rights, help you challenge unconstitutional laws or actions, represent you in court, and ensure that you receive fair treatment under constitutional protections.

Can businesses assert constitutional rights in Cerritos?

Yes, businesses can assert certain constitutional rights, such as equal protection, due process, and sometimes free speech, when dealing with local or state regulations.
